Kaugummi – Is It Halal?
Snabbsvar
Kaugummi is classified as halal. Chewing gum (kaugummi) typically consists of a gum base, which may be derived from synthetic polymers, plant-based resins (e.g., chicle), or other sources. Without specific information about the source of the gum base or additives (e.g., gelatin, stearic acid), the halal status is generally considered HALAL unless haram additives (e.g., alcohol, pork-derived ingredients) are present.
